How many students attend Summit Leadership Academy-High Desert?
Summit Leadership Academy-High Desert has 253 students enrolled. It is a public school in Hesperia, CA. CCD year-over-year: 224 (2022-23) → 207 (2023-24), down 17.
What is the student-teacher ratio at Summit Leadership Academy-High Desert?
The student-teacher ratio at Summit Leadership Academy-High Desert is 25.3:1, which is 18% higher than the California average of 21.5:1 and 61% higher than the national average of 15.7:1.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Summit Leadership Academy-High Desert?
76.3% of students at Summit Leadership Academy-High Desert are eligible for free lunch, compared to the California average of 55.5%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Summit Leadership Academy-High Desert?
The largest demographic group at Summit Leadership Academy-High Desert is Hispanic or Latino at 70.4% of enrollment, in Hesperia, CA.
